US Explores Deep-Sea Mining to Counter China's Rare Earth Dominance

The Trump administration is negotiating with The Metals Company for a deep-sea mining permit in the Clarion-Clipperton Zone to secure critical metals, bypassing international regulations amid trade tensions with China, raising environmental and legal concerns.

Delayed Ukrainian Lithium Mining Amidst US-Ukraine Deal Stalemate

The depopulated Ukrainian villages of Połochiwka and Kopanki, home to a potentially massive lithium deposit (40 million tons), face delayed mining due to environmental concerns and a stalled US-Ukraine resource deal; this delay impacts local economic prospects.

Ukraine Rejects US Mineral Deal, Citing Sovereignty Concerns

Ukraine rejected a US proposal on post-war mineral resource development, citing sovereignty concerns; negotiations continue with a Ukrainian delegation visiting the US for talks, including representatives from an international law firm.

China's Arctic Assertion: Icebreakers Navigate New Geopolitical Landscape

Three Chinese icebreakers successfully completed an Arctic transit in July-August 2024, symbolizing China's growing influence in the region amid climate-driven ice melt opening potential new shipping routes and access to vast mineral resources, prompting reactions from Russia and the US.

Alaska Uranium Mine Threatens Indigenous Community

The Iñupiat community of Elim, Alaska, opposes a planned uranium mine by Panther Minerals near their village, fearing water contamination and health risks, despite the state granting an exploration permit.

Greenland's Mineral Wealth: A Balancing Act Between Opportunity and Risk

Greenland's substantial mineral reserves, including rare earth elements and potentially oil and gas, are attracting significant international interest despite logistical challenges, environmental concerns, and uncertain economic viability.

US Considers Unilateral Deep-Sea Mining, Bypassing International Authority

The Trump administration may unilaterally mine polymetallic nodules from international waters, disregarding the International Seabed Authority (ISA) and raising concerns about environmental damage and international law.

Trump's National Park Cuts Spark Protests Amidst Record Visitation

President Trump's budget cuts to the National Park Service resulted in the dismissal of 1000 employees, sparking protests and legal challenges amidst record-high visitor numbers (332 million in 2024) and the administration's concurrent expansion of resource extraction within the parks.

Zelensky Weighs Rejection of US Mineral Deal Amidst Criticism

Ukrainian President Zelensky is considering rejecting a US-proposed mineral extraction agreement that would grant the US significant control over Ukraine's resources and revenues, prompting strong internal criticism within Ukraine.

Murmansk Forum Focuses on Arctic Development and International Cooperation

The International Arctic Forum in Murmansk (March 26-27) will address Arctic development, focusing on the Northern Sea Route, investments, infrastructure, and international cooperation, aiming to balance economic growth with environmental protection.
